Coronavirus: Uptick in Canada’s daily cases associated with young adults, health official says

Speaking with reporters on Tuesday, Deputy Chief Public Health Office of Canada Dr. Howard Njoo remarked on the recent uptick of daily coronavirus cases in Canada, saying the vast majority of the increase in the proportion of cases is among young adults. Dr. Njoo said there were a number of reasons to explain the increase, including fatigue, more likely to have indoor parties, and the “invincible factor” of young people who are most likely to have mild or asymptomatic symptoms of COVID-19.
